The DeSoto Parish School Wellness Department partnered with NAUW Mansfield Branch in sponsoring GLOW 2023. Three of the district's four high schools were represented during the event. Fanetta Houston and Worlita Jackson presented on Mental Health and Social Emotional Learning. The SEL activity done on self-awareness was AMAZING!

We are pleased to announce the following administrative appointments for DeSoto Parish Schools. Mr. Brandon Burback-Supervisor of Administration, Mr. Kevin Gardner-Supervisor of Student Services, and Mr. Chris Bush-LHS Principal, have all played an integral role in the education for our students and have excelled in their current positions. They are eager to continue supporting students and staff as they begin their new leadership positions. #TheDeSotoDifference

In partnership with AEP SWEPCO, NLTCC has created a 32-week lineman program that starts in June. You can earn your CDL and more throughout this course. Click the link, rb.gy/k4oij, or scan the QR code for more info! #DeSotoStrong
